Chiavetta wi-fi usb Dlink DWA-140 B3 e Ubuntu 16.04

Networking, configurazione della connessione, periferiche e condivisioni di rete.
Scrivi risposta
rocker81
Prode Principiante
Messaggi: 7
Iscrizione: venerdì 20 maggio 2016, 0:21

Chiavetta wi-fi usb Dlink DWA-140 B3 e Ubuntu 16.04

Messaggio da rocker81 »

Ciao, se qualcuno ha la stessa chiavetta usb o sa come risolvere avrei bisogno di un aiuto. Utilizzo da tempo su Ubuntu 14.04 una chiavetta usb wi-fi D-Link Corp. DWA-140 RangeBooster N Adapter(rev.B3) [Ralink RT5372] (come da comando lsusb).
Funziona anche con il driver incluso nel kernel, rt2800usb, ma il segnale è intermedio. Perciò spulciando sulla rete avevo trovato questa dritta http://ubuntuforums.org/showthread.php? ... st13006335 che prevede l'utilizzo del driver rt5370sta al posto di rt2800usb. Con questo driver il segnale è mediamente più forte anche se non sempre costante.
Non so se questo possa influire sulla velocità di internet o comunque della rete locale. Sembrerebbe di no, ma mi è rimasto il dubbio.
Vorrei ora installare da zero Ubuntu 16.04 e perciò ho provato una live usb. Sembra che il driver rt2800usb funzioni ma allo stesso modo che su 14.04, segnale intermedio anche se comunque costante.
Purtroppo però il trucco del forum per installare il driver rt5370sta non funziona più: arrivato al comando sudo dkms build -m Ralink_5370sta -v 2.5.0.3 restituisce errore e non completa l'installazione.
Non trovo per ora nuove soluzioni al problema. Ero riuscito a risolvere su Ubuntu 14.04 ma niente da fare sul 16.04.
rocker81
Prode Principiante
Messaggi: 7
Iscrizione: venerdì 20 maggio 2016, 0:21

Re: Chiavetta wi-fi usb Dlink DWA-140 B3 e Ubuntu 16.04

Messaggio da rocker81 »

Mmm...nessuno ha questo problema o nessuno ha idea di come risolvere?
Comunque, ho provato su live usb con 16.04 e internet va a 4 Mbit (che è lo standard qui da me), mentre la live usb con 14.04 va a 2-3 Mbit. Forse che 16.04 gestisce meglio il driver rt2800usb incluso nel kernel?
Avatar utente
magozurlinux
Accecante Asceta
Accecante Asceta
Messaggi: 25004
Iscrizione: mercoledì 17 marzo 2010, 17:44
Desktop: xubuntu
Distribuzione: Xubuntu 22.04.3 LTS x86_64
Sesso: Maschile
Località: Pisa

Re: Chiavetta wi-fi usb Dlink DWA-140 B3 e Ubuntu 16.04

Messaggio da magozurlinux »

Prova con questa guida:

Scarica questi driver?

http://www.mediatek.com/en/downloads1/d ... 2-usb-usb/

segui questa guida:

http://luismi.sanchezarteaga.es/instala ... 12-04-lts/

Dovrebbe andare bene anche con la 16.04 se non hanno cambiato PATH di configurazioni.

quando dice:

Codice: Seleziona tutto

$ cd Descargas
digita cd Scaricati
Xubuntu 22.04 LTS - saluti da magozurlinux a tutti gli utenti del forum :ciao:
rocker81
Prode Principiante
Messaggi: 7
Iscrizione: venerdì 20 maggio 2016, 0:21

Re: Chiavetta wi-fi usb Dlink DWA-140 B3 e Ubuntu 16.04

Messaggio da rocker81 »

Ciao, ti ringrazio, ho provato ugualmente con la Live USB di Ubuntu 16.04 anche se la guida che mi hai indicato è molto simile a un'altra che avevo trovato quando ero in procinto di installare Ubuntu 13.04, che se non ricordo male in effetti aveva proprio seri problemi con quella chiavetta wi-fi, non trovava proprio la rete.
In quel caso aveva funzionato e aveva utilizzato quel driver.
Ma già da Ubuntu 14.04 quel metodo non ha più funzionato, tant'è che ho trovato poi la guida per installare il driver dkms (che con 14.04 è andato bene).

Adesso con Ubuntu 16.04 non funziona più nè il metodo per 13.04 nè quello per 14.04.
Seguendo la procedura, quando si fa il make comincia una serie di errori, verso la fine dice questo:

Codice: Seleziona tutto

recipe for target '/home/ubuntu/Desktop/2012RT8070_RT3070_RT3370_RT3572_RT5370_RT5372_RT5572_USB_LinuxSTA_2.6.1.3/os/linux/../../sta/sta_cfg.o' failed
make[2]: *** [/home/ubuntu/Desktop/2012RT8070_RT3070_RT3370_RT3572_RT5370_RT5372_RT5572_USB_LinuxSTA_2.6.1.3/os/linux/../../sta/sta_cfg.o] Error 1
Makefile:1396: recipe for target '_module_/home/ubuntu/Desktop/2012RT8070_RT3070_RT3370_RT3572_RT5370_RT5372_RT5572_USB_LinuxSTA_2.6.1.3/os/linux' failed
make[1]: *** [_module_/home/ubuntu/Desktop/2012RT8070_RT3070_RT3370_RT3572_RT5370_RT5372_RT5572_USB_LinuxSTA_2.6.1.3/os/linux] Error 2
make[1]: Leaving directory '/usr/src/linux-headers-4.4.0-21-generic'
Makefile:388: recipe for target 'LINUX' failed
make: *** [LINUX] Error 2
La buona notizia è che pare che il driver rt2800usb incluso nel kernel funziona davvero bene su questa versione di Ubuntu (a differenza anche della 14.04). Mi aveva scoraggiato il fatto che il segnale graficamente è più basso (però stabile), ma facendo delle prove sia con la velocità internet sia della rete locale non ho riscontrato problemi, sono le velocità tipiche, le stesse che ho su Ubuntu 14.04 con il driver rt5370sta e in generale anche con i computer Windows di casa.
Per dire, facendo iwconfig in due momenti diversi ho ottenuto questi risultati (ho inserito qui solo quello che mi sembra rilevante):
iwconfig 1: Bit Rate=24 Mb/s Tx-Power=20 dBm Link Quality=37/70 Signal level=-73 dBm
iwconfig 2: Bit Rate=18 Mb/s Tx-Power=20 dBm Link Quality=35/70 Signal level=-75 dBm
Non so se sia tanto o poco, qualcuno se ne intende? Il pc non è molto vicino al router, è in un'altra stanza al piano superiore.
Però mi sembra che va bene, a questo punto è pure superfluo cercare di installare un altro driver.
Avatar utente
magozurlinux
Accecante Asceta
Accecante Asceta
Messaggi: 25004
Iscrizione: mercoledì 17 marzo 2010, 17:44
Desktop: xubuntu
Distribuzione: Xubuntu 22.04.3 LTS x86_64
Sesso: Maschile
Località: Pisa

Re: Chiavetta wi-fi usb Dlink DWA-140 B3 e Ubuntu 16.04

Messaggio da magozurlinux »

Il make da errori perchè hanno cambiato il PATH per la compilazione del driver.

Da terminale postami questi comandi:

Codice: Seleziona tutto

sudo ifconfig -a

Codice: Seleziona tutto

sudo lshw -C network
Xubuntu 22.04 LTS - saluti da magozurlinux a tutti gli utenti del forum :ciao:
rocker81
Prode Principiante
Messaggi: 7
Iscrizione: venerdì 20 maggio 2016, 0:21

Re: Chiavetta wi-fi usb Dlink DWA-140 B3 e Ubuntu 16.04

Messaggio da rocker81 »

Codice: Seleziona tutto

sudo ifconfig -a

Codice: Seleziona tutto

enp2s0    Link encap:Ethernet  IndirizzoHW 8c:89:a5:6e:f1:ef  
          UP BROADCAST MULTICAST  MTU:1500  Metric:1
          RX packets:0 errors:0 dropped:0 overruns:0 frame:0
          TX packets:0 errors:0 dropped:0 overruns:0 carrier:0
          collisioni:0 txqueuelen:1000 
          Byte RX:0 (0.0 B)  Byte TX:0 (0.0 B)

lo        Link encap:Loopback locale  
          indirizzo inet:127.0.0.1  Maschera:255.0.0.0
          indirizzo inet6: ::1/128 Scope:Host
          UP LOOPBACK RUNNING  MTU:65536  Metric:1
          RX packets:390 errors:0 dropped:0 overruns:0 frame:0
          TX packets:390 errors:0 dropped:0 overruns:0 carrier:0
          collisioni:0 txqueuelen:1 
          Byte RX:31089 (31.0 KB)  Byte TX:31089 (31.0 KB)

wlxc8d3a30bb1aa Link encap:Ethernet  IndirizzoHW c8:d3:a3:0b:b1:aa  
          indirizzo inet:192.168.1.4  Bcast:192.168.1.255  Maschera:255.255.255.0
          indirizzo inet6: fe80::cad3:a3ff:fe0b:b1aa/64 Scope:Link
          UP BROADCAST RUNNING MULTICAST  MTU:1500  Metric:1
          RX packets:13408 errors:0 dropped:0 overruns:0 frame:0
          TX packets:9225 errors:0 dropped:0 overruns:0 carrier:0
          collisioni:0 txqueuelen:1000 
          Byte RX:14060953 (14.0 MB)  Byte TX:1329669 (1.3 MB)

Codice: Seleziona tutto

sudo lshw -C network

Codice: Seleziona tutto

 *-network               
       description: Ethernet interface
       product: AR8131 Gigabit Ethernet
       vendor: Qualcomm Atheros
       physical id: 0
       bus info: pci@0000:02:00.0
       logical name: enp2s0
       version: c0
       serial: 8c:89:a5:6e:f1:ef
       capacity: 1Gbit/s
       width: 64 bits
       clock: 33MHz
       capabilities: pm msi pciexpress vpd bus_master cap_list ethernet physical tp 10bt 10bt-fd 100bt 100bt-fd 1000bt-fd autonegotiation
       configuration: autonegotiation=on broadcast=yes driver=atl1c driverversion=1.0.1.1-NAPI latency=0 link=no multicast=yes port=twisted pair
       resources: irq:29 memory:febc0000-febfffff ioport:ec00(size=128)
  *-network
       description: Wireless interface
       physical id: 1
       bus info: usb@1:6
       logical name: wlxc8d3a30bb1aa
       serial: c8:d3:a3:0b:b1:aa
       capabilities: ethernet physical wireless
       configuration: broadcast=yes driver=rt2800usb driverversion=4.4.0-22-generic firmware=0.29 ip=192.168.1.4 link=yes multicast=yes wireless=IEEE 802.11bgn
Avatar utente
magozurlinux
Accecante Asceta
Accecante Asceta
Messaggi: 25004
Iscrizione: mercoledì 17 marzo 2010, 17:44
Desktop: xubuntu
Distribuzione: Xubuntu 22.04.3 LTS x86_64
Sesso: Maschile
Località: Pisa

Re: Chiavetta wi-fi usb Dlink DWA-140 B3 e Ubuntu 16.04

Messaggio da magozurlinux »

wlxc8d3a30bb1aa Link encap:Ethernet IndirizzoHW c8:d3:a3:0b:b1:aa
indirizzo inet:192.168.1.4 Bcast:192.168.1.255 Maschera:255.255.255.0
indirizzo inet6: fe80::cad3:a3ff:fe0b:b1aa/64 Scope:Link
UP BROADCAST RUNNING MULTICAST MTU:1500 Metric:1
RX packets:13408 errors:0 dropped:0 overruns:0 frame:0
TX packets:9225 errors:0 dropped:0 overruns:0 carrier:0
collisioni:0 txqueuelen:1000
Byte RX:14060953 (14.0 MB) Byte TX:1329669 (1.3 MB)
Hai l'IPv6 attivo.

Clicca in alto a dx sull'icona di NM, vai in basso su Modifica connessioni...; clicca su Senza fili, seleziona la tua rete wireless, clicca su Modifica, vai su Impostazioni IPv6, mettilo su Ignora e clicca in basso a dx su Salva.

Disconnettiti e riconnettiti ad Internet, vedi se funziona meglio.


Da terminale postami questo comando:

Codice: Seleziona tutto

dmesg | grep rt2800usb
Xubuntu 22.04 LTS - saluti da magozurlinux a tutti gli utenti del forum :ciao:
rocker81
Prode Principiante
Messaggi: 7
Iscrizione: venerdì 20 maggio 2016, 0:21

Re: Chiavetta wi-fi usb Dlink DWA-140 B3 e Ubuntu 16.04

Messaggio da rocker81 »

Codice: Seleziona tutto

dmesg | grep rt2800usb

Codice: Seleziona tutto

[   13.382637] usbcore: registered new interface driver rt2800usb
[   13.432236] rt2800usb 1-6:1.0 wlxc8d3a30bb1aa: renamed from wlan0
Avatar utente
magozurlinux
Accecante Asceta
Accecante Asceta
Messaggi: 25004
Iscrizione: mercoledì 17 marzo 2010, 17:44
Desktop: xubuntu
Distribuzione: Xubuntu 22.04.3 LTS x86_64
Sesso: Maschile
Località: Pisa

Re: Chiavetta wi-fi usb Dlink DWA-140 B3 e Ubuntu 16.04

Messaggio da magozurlinux »

Segui questa guida:

http://forum.ubuntu-it.org/viewtopic.ph ... mobile=off

rimuovi il pacchetto che hai scaricato precedentemente ed anche la cartella creata con lo scompattamento.

Dovrebbe andare bene anche con la 16.04.
Xubuntu 22.04 LTS - saluti da magozurlinux a tutti gli utenti del forum :ciao:
rocker81
Prode Principiante
Messaggi: 7
Iscrizione: venerdì 20 maggio 2016, 0:21

Re: Chiavetta wi-fi usb Dlink DWA-140 B3 e Ubuntu 16.04

Messaggio da rocker81 »

Riprendo questa discussione, casomai anche qualcuno fosse interessato, perchè ho notato che con il driver rt2800usb su Ubuntu 16.04 mi appare spesso nel syslog (anche se non tutti i giorni) un messaggio di questo tipo: wpa_supplicant[1316]: wlxc8d3a30bb1aa: CTRL-EVENT-DISCONNECTED bssid=[miobssid] reason=4 locally_generated=1
Sembra cioè che il wi-fi si disconnetta per un attimo. Di solito si riconnette in automatico. A volte, per fortuna raramente, mi chiede persino di nuovo la password. Non sembra un problema grave ma a volte è fastidioso.
Con il driver rt5370sta su Ubuntu 14.04 nessun messaggio del genere.
iwconfig

Codice: Seleziona tutto

wlxc8d3a30bb1aa IEEE 802.11bgn ESSID:"[miossid]"
Mode:Managed Frequency:2.412 GHz Access Point: [mac]
Bit Rate=11 Mb/s Tx-Power=20 dBm
Retry short limit:7 RTS thr:off Fragment thr:off
Power Management:off
Link Quality=31/70 Signal level=-79 dBm
Rx invalid nwid:0 Rx invalid crypt:0 Rx invalid frag:0
Tx excessive retries:3 Invalid misc:79 Missed beacon:0
Scrivi risposta

Ritorna a “Connessione e configurazione delle reti”

Chi c’è in linea

Visualizzano questa sezione: 0 utenti iscritti e 2 ospiti